The modernization of the Plate Mill at People Steel Mills (PSM) focused on the implementation of an advanced descaling system to enhance operational efficiency, product quality, and energy performance. Supplied by INTECO Rolling Mill Technologies, this targeted upgrade improves the production of alloy and special steels while contributing to more sustainable plant operation.

A key element of the project is the installation of a two-stage descaling system, consisting of a primary descaler at the furnace exit and a secondary descaler at the roughing stand entry. This configuration effectively removes both primary and secondary scale, leading to improved surface quality and reduced defect rates. In particular, the surface quality of high-alloy plates is significantly improved through proper descaling of the slabs. The system is designed to handle a wide range of input materials, including blooms, slab ingots, and continuous cast slabs. It incorporates real-time laser-based thickness measurement for automatic height adjustment, optimized nozzle positioning, and adaptable descaling forces tailored to different steel grades.

The paper provides an overview of the entire project, from the early conceptual stage through to successful implementation. It outlines the key technical features of the installed system and presents operational results, as well as practical experiences gained during commissioning and production.
